新聞中心
Access數(shù)據(jù)庫是一個功能強(qiáng)大的數(shù)據(jù)庫管理工具,許多企業(yè)和組織都在使用它來存儲和管理大量數(shù)據(jù)。其中一個常見的需求是獲取當(dāng)前時間并將其保存到數(shù)據(jù)庫中。

為通山等地區(qū)用戶提供了全套網(wǎng)頁設(shè)計制作服務(wù),及通山網(wǎng)站建設(shè)行業(yè)解決方案。主營業(yè)務(wù)為網(wǎng)站制作、成都做網(wǎng)站、通山網(wǎng)站設(shè)計,以傳統(tǒng)方式定制建設(shè)網(wǎng)站,并提供域名空間備案等一條龍服務(wù),秉承以專業(yè)、用心的態(tài)度為用戶提供真誠的服務(wù)。我們深信只要達(dá)到每一位用戶的要求,就會得到認(rèn)可,從而選擇與我們長期合作。這樣,我們也可以走得更遠(yuǎn)!
在本文中,我們將介紹如何使用access數(shù)據(jù)庫獲取當(dāng)前時間。
之一步:創(chuàng)建數(shù)據(jù)庫表格
我們需要創(chuàng)建一個數(shù)據(jù)庫表格來存儲當(dāng)前時間。打開Access數(shù)據(jù)庫,選擇新建空白數(shù)據(jù)庫,并命名為“TimeDB”。然后,點擊“創(chuàng)建”標(biāo)簽頁,選擇“表格設(shè)計”。
在設(shè)計視圖中,選擇“新建字段”按鈕,并創(chuàng)建一個名為“CurrentTime”的字段,數(shù)據(jù)類型為“時間/日期”。
第二步:添加記錄和代碼
接下來,我們需要添加一條記錄并編寫代碼來獲取當(dāng)前時間并將其保存到數(shù)據(jù)庫中。
回到數(shù)據(jù)庫的“數(shù)據(jù)表”視圖,選擇“添加記錄”按鈕,并添加一條記錄。在“CurrentTime”字段中,輸入函數(shù)“=Now()”,它將在當(dāng)前日期和時間處顯示當(dāng)前日期和時間。
然后,我們需要編寫代碼來將當(dāng)前時間保存到數(shù)據(jù)庫中。按下“ALT+F11”鍵打開Visual Basic編輯器。選擇“模塊”并單擊“新建”。輸入以下代碼:
Private Sub SaveTime()
Dim strConnection As String
Dim cnn As ADODB.Connection
Dim sql As String
strConnection = “Provider=Microsoft.ACE.OLEDB.12.0;Data Source=TimeDB.accdb;Persist Security Info=False;”
Set cnn = New ADODB.Connection
cnn.Open strConnection
sql = “INSERT INTO tblTime (CurrentTime) VALUES (#” & Now() & “#)”
cnn.Execute sql
cnn.Close
Set cnn = Nothing
End Sub
此代碼使用ADODB連接到數(shù)據(jù)庫,并使用INSERT語句將當(dāng)前時間寫入數(shù)據(jù)表的字段“CurrentTime”中。請注意,這里我們使用“#”將當(dāng)前時間包含在SQL語句中。
第三步:運行代碼并驗證結(jié)果
保存上述代碼并返回Access數(shù)據(jù)庫,將光標(biāo)移到添加的記錄行并單擊“制表符”鍵。選擇“事件”標(biāo)簽頁,并選擇“單擊”事件。
單擊“生成事件過程”按鈕并輸入以下代碼:
Private Sub Form_Click()
SaveTime
End Sub
此代碼將在單擊該表格時調(diào)用“SaveTime”函數(shù),并將當(dāng)前時間保存到數(shù)據(jù)庫中。
現(xiàn)在,讓我們運行代碼并驗證結(jié)果。按下F5鍵或單擊運行按鈕以編譯代碼。然后,單擊表格以記錄當(dāng)前時間。轉(zhuǎn)到“數(shù)據(jù)表”視圖以查看保存的時間,如下所示:
從上圖可以看出,當(dāng)前時間已被成功保存到數(shù)據(jù)庫中。
結(jié)論:
Access數(shù)據(jù)庫提供了各種方法來管理數(shù)據(jù)和存儲當(dāng)前時間。通過創(chuàng)建一個數(shù)據(jù)庫表格來存儲當(dāng)前時間,并使用Visual Basic編寫代碼將當(dāng)前時間保存到該表格中,我們可以輕松地實現(xiàn)這個目標(biāo)。這是一個簡單而有效的方法,可以幫助我們在Excel數(shù)據(jù)庫中管理和跟蹤時間。
相關(guān)問題拓展閱讀:
- sql語言向access數(shù)據(jù)庫中插入時間是什么格式,怎么從系統(tǒng)中獲得時間呢,獲得后又怎么插入呢
- ASP從access數(shù)據(jù)庫中讀取顯示時間格式為2023/12/29 00:00:00,怎么樣才能把時分秒也顯示出來?
sql語言向access數(shù)據(jù)庫中插入時間是什么格式,怎么從系統(tǒng)中獲得時間呢,獲得后又怎么插入呢
1)用Now()函跡中數(shù)獲取系統(tǒng)時間
2)INSERT INTO 表者拍1 ( 日姿嫌山期時間字段 ) SELECT Now()
3)時間是什么格式?Date型數(shù)據(jù),想要輸出什么樣的格式是需要你來定義的
ASP從access數(shù)據(jù)庫中讀取顯示時間格式為2023/12/29 00:00:00,怎么樣才能把時分秒也顯示出來?
你這主要是網(wǎng)頁獲取的的時間長度短沒有分秒,試試用now()這函數(shù)獲取時間
首先,你進(jìn)數(shù)據(jù)庫查看下,你的時間格式是怎么樣的,如果數(shù)據(jù)庫內(nèi)的時間類別中不包含時分秒。
那你怎么弄,顯示出來的都只會是00:00:00,反之,如果數(shù)據(jù)內(nèi)有時分秒,那顯示出來就簡單了。代碼如下:
‘你的目的是,日期用“/”分開,時分稱用”:”分開;以下代碼,你可以任意自己替換分開的符號。
‘假設(shè)你的數(shù)據(jù)庫時間值為 date_SFM
數(shù)據(jù)庫設(shè)計的時候,時間字段默認(rèn)值填寫Now()即可,然后ASP程序中就不用寫時間字段的值入庫了,只要有新紀(jì)錄,就會自動紀(jì)錄入庫的時間。
access數(shù)據(jù)庫獲取當(dāng)前時間的介紹就聊到這里吧,感謝你花時間閱讀本站內(nèi)容,更多關(guān)于access數(shù)據(jù)庫獲取當(dāng)前時間,如何使用Access數(shù)據(jù)庫獲取當(dāng)前時間?,sql語言向access數(shù)據(jù)庫中插入時間是什么格式,怎么從系統(tǒng)中獲得時間呢,獲得后又怎么插入呢,ASP從access數(shù)據(jù)庫中讀取顯示時間格式為2023/12/29 00:00:00,怎么樣才能把時分秒也顯示出來?的信息別忘了在本站進(jìn)行查找喔。
香港服務(wù)器選創(chuàng)新互聯(lián),2H2G首月10元開通。
創(chuàng)新互聯(lián)(www.cdcxhl.com)互聯(lián)網(wǎng)服務(wù)提供商,擁有超過10年的服務(wù)器租用、服務(wù)器托管、云服務(wù)器、虛擬主機(jī)、網(wǎng)站系統(tǒng)開發(fā)經(jīng)驗。專業(yè)提供云主機(jī)、虛擬主機(jī)、域名注冊、VPS主機(jī)、云服務(wù)器、香港云服務(wù)器、免備案服務(wù)器等。
新聞標(biāo)題:如何使用Access數(shù)據(jù)庫獲取當(dāng)前時間?(access數(shù)據(jù)庫獲取當(dāng)前時間)
本文鏈接:http://www.dlmjj.cn/article/djijhhj.html


咨詢
建站咨詢
